There is, at least kind of(f) :)
You have to go into service menu->Option->MRT Option and disable "Instant On" and "Always Instant On Support" (path and availability of options may vary between models, here KS). TV will then enter in *true* standby.

Of course I understand what you mean, and that's why I said "kind of", but there's a huge difference between both: In "instant" mode, TV shuts off screen/audio and devices, but system remains fully ON and ready (->root active!), and power consumption is of some watts, whereas options disabled only micom is responsive, and TV really boots up when you power it on (like known standby up to F series), and there consumption is only about 0.01W (which is much closer to "unplugged", even if not strictly the same I agree, but I think it was the sense of question ;) )
